Early , Oak Longcase 11" Brass Dial

An early Oak cased , 11" full Brass dial , Longcase clock . The Trunk door is the entire length with a panelled arch feature , the base which is in good original condition - unusual for a clock of this age , has a slightly convexed front . The superb dial was almost certainly made by the clockmaker it has the quarter Hour divisions with fluer-de-lys on the half hour markers , ringed winding holes and a small square date aperture . The columns have bronze octagonal capitals - above and below . The movement which has an inside Strike countwheel has two finely ringed pillars and early wheel work is driven by two ringed topped cast lead weights , This clock is unsigned and truly unique .
